Great Skate expected to raise $10K

Event will benefit Griffins Youth Foundation

GRAND RAPIDS, Mich. (WOOD) - The eighth annual Great Skate drew big crowds to Rosa Parks Circle on Sunday.

Each player on the Grand Rapids Griffins skated for at least one hour with fans, as did some members of the media, including Marc Thompson, Laura Velasquez, Terri DeBoer and Larry Figurski. The money raised went toward the Griffins Youth Foundation.

Organizers are expecting to collect more than $10,000 to benefit underprivileged and physically challenged children in West Michigan.

The Great Skate continues until 10 p.m. Sunday.
